Indian-administered Kashmir has become a difficult and dangerous place for journalists. The number of regional media outlets still tackling critical stories continues to shrink. The Kashmir Walla is one that persists. Its founder and editor, Fahad Shah, is in prison and awaiting trial. Newsroom Without an Editor follows 23-year-old interim editor Yashraj Sharma as he works to keep the magazine going amid worsening conditions for journalists.
